Abstract

These provisions lay down measures for the protection of animals used for scientific or educational purposes. They transpose Directive 2010/63/EU on the protection of animals used for scientific purposes. The Regulations provide rules concerning the following: (a) the replacement and reduction of the use of animals in procedures and the refinement of the breeding, accommodation, care and use of animals in procedures; (b) the origin, breeding, marking, care and accommodation and killing of animals; (c) the operations of breeders, suppliers and users; (d) the evaluation and authorization of projects involving the use of animals in procedures.
